    The Cryptophagidae (Coleoptera) of the Maltese Islands are reviewed based on material of earlier records and recent collections. A total of twelve species are reported, of which Micrambe mediterranica OTERO & JOHNSON sp.n. is described from material collected in Malta, Greece and Jordan.peer-reviewe

    Treballs Finals de Grau de Física, Facultat de Física, Universitat de Barcelona, Curs: 2017, Tutor: Antoni Planes VilaThis work is a review that deals with the possibility of application of statistical mechanics into granular systems. Some modifications of statistical mechanics concepts are introduced in order to apply statistical methods to these systems. The quadron method is proposed to determine correctly the degrees of freedom of granular systems. The total partition function is computed, and it is shown that it gives rise to an equipartition principle for granular systems. In section IV, the failure in the description of granular matter with the volume function, and a reformulation aimed at overcoming such problems is proposed. Section V discuss the possibility of using the above result in the Jamming transition problem. Finally, a personal perspective is given on this topic

    Màster universitari en Estudis Avançats en Arquitectura: Gestió i Valoració Urbana i ArquitectònicaEn este trabajo se presenta un análisis territorial del Principado de Asturias dando así a conocer el ámbito de estudio y posteriormente se realiza otro análisis de la reestructuración urbana reciente en el Principado de Asturias generada por los cambios en la organización empresarial y productiva, además de cambios en las preferencias de asentamientos poblacionales. Se proporciona evidencia de la existencia de subcentros metropolitanos que continúan consolidándose como auténticos nodos de influencia y referencia para los territorios de su alrededor a partir de análisis de flujos de movilidad laboral que permiten captar la interacción entre estos y sus áreas de influencia. También se hace una comparación entre Oviedo y Gijón como candidatos a ejercer de centro jerárquico del Área Metropolitana Asturiana. Y finalmente, se concluye la existencia de una estructura urbana mixta entre policentrismo y dispersión donde existen diferentes núcleos con capacidad para influir en sus entornos

    El artículo estudia la gestión reciente de RTPA a partir de una serie de controvertidas prácticas empresariales, laborales y lingüísticas habituales en el período 2006-2011, sobre todo, la opacidad en la contratación, la alta remuneración de directivos, las cesiones de trabajadores y el desinterés por la lengua autóctona. Más específicamente, el texto relaciona la evolución de esas prácticas con la acción política en torno a RTPA desde 2012. La conclusión principal es que la prioridad del poder político en estos tres años ha sido mantener el control sobre RTPA y ofrecer una apariencia de austeridad, no resolver las disfunciones citadas.The article examines the governance and administration of the regional pubcaster RTPA. It first looks at some corporate malpractices RTPA indulged in throughout the period 2006-2011, most notably opaque procurement processes, illegal outsourcing, overpayment of executives and lack of interest in Asturian, the local minority language it is statutorily bound to promote. Next, we consider whether these misdeeds have been addressed by regional television policy since 2012 or allowed to continue uncorrected. By way of conclusion, we propose that regional political representatives have been much more interested in keeping RTPA under tight political control than in correcting the above malpractices

    Three species of Telmatophilus Heer, 1841 in the Western Palaearctic Region are revised. Basing on studies of the types of the species, Telmatophilus brevicollis Aubé, 1862, T. caricis (Olivier, 1790) and T. typhae (Fallén, 1802) are redescribed. Two new synonymies are established: Cryptophagus sparganii Ahrens, 1812 = Telmatophilus caricis (Olivier, 1790) and Cryptophagus schonherrii Gyllenhal, 1808 = Telmatophilus typhae (Fallén, 1802). Species are redefined according to their morphology, including that of the genitalia. A key of the studied species is included

    SERS spectra of pyridine has been recorded on a silver electrode in a potential range from 0.0 to -1.20 V with a saline solution, pyridine / KCl (0.1M / 0.1M), by using the 514.5 nm exciting line by us [1]. Under these experimental conditions, the maximum intensity of the enhanced 8a and 9a bands is reached at -0.75 V and -1.20 V, respectively, being the 9a band what dominates the spectrum at negative electrode potential. Although this behavior has been explained under a resonant charge transfer mechanism, the nature of the electronic resonance processes involved in the enhancement of each band is different. The 8a band is enhanced due to an electronic excitation between the ground and excited charge transfer electronic state of the metal-adsorbate surface complex, while the activity of the 9a band is due to a plasmon-like excitation taking into account an overall electronic structure of small metal clusters [2] which is able to selectively modify the relative intensities of specific SERS band. We intend now to record pyridine SERS spectra under the same experimental conditions but varying only the type of electrolyte in order to check how it affects the relative intensities and vibrational wavenumbers of the bands as well as the electrode potential to which the enhanced bands reach the maximum intensity. Different electrolytes like KCl, NaCl, KBr, NaBr and Na2SO4, have been selected in such way that allows us to compare SERS spectra in which changes only the cation or the anion of the electrolyte. From the analysis of all these SERS spectra, it can be concluded that no significant wavenumbers shifts have been detected, while the relative intensities of the bands and the electrode potential to which the maximum intensity is reached are slightly modified. NaBr electrolyte requieres more negative electrode potential in order to enhance the 8a and 9a bands and to resolve the 12 and 1 pair.     This research deals with the design of a logistics strategy with a collaborative approach between non-competing companies, who through joint coordination of the replenishment of their inventories reduce their costs thanks to the exploitation of economies of scale. The collaboration scope includes sharing logistic resources with limited capacities; transport units, warehouses, and management processes. These elements conform a novel extension of the Joint Replenishment Problem (JRP) named the Schochastic Collaborative Joint replenishment Problem (S-CJRP). The introduction of this model helps to increase practical elements into the inventory replenishment problem and to assess to what extent collaboration in inventory replenishment and logistics resources sharing might reduce the inventory costs. Overall, results showed that the proposed model could be a viable alternative to reduce logistics costs and demonstrated how the model can be a financially preferred alternative than individual investments to leverage resources capacity expansions.     Eight species of the genus Cryptophagus Herbst, 1792, belonging to the “dentatus group” from the Palearctic Region are revised. The opinions of different authors about the value of the characteristics of the external anatomy are contrasted, and an identification key and figures of the studied species are presented

    Isonicotinic (IN) acid is one of the three monocarboxilic derivatives of pyridine in which the acid group is located in para-position of the heterocyclic ring. It is a weak acid (pK2=4.86) and therefore, it is not completely ionized in neutral aqueous solutions, being the zwitterion and the anion the majority chemical species at neutral pH. In acidic solutions (pK1=1.84) the pyridinic nitrogen atom can be protonated yielding a third chemical species with positive charge [1]. In addition, IN acid shows two functional centres that can interact with the silver metallic surface such as the carboxilate group and the aromatic nitrogen atom. Therefore, the analysis of the SERS spectra of IN has been focused on identifying the chemical species adsorbed on the silver surface and its centre of interaction by considering the participation of a photoinduced charge-transfer (CT) mechanism in each particular SERS record as we have previously detected in the SERS of pyridine derivatives [2]. SERS spectra of the IN acid (5x10-3 M) have been recorded on silver at electrode potentials ranging from 0.00 up to -1.00 V and at different pH by using 0.1 M Na2SO4 aqueous solution as electrolyte. The figure shows the SERS recorded at basic pH. The experimental set up is described elsewhere and the excitation line of 514.5 nm wavelength was used. [2].
